The Master's Approach to the White Work Shirt

A crisp white work shirt is a wardrobe staple, flexible enough for presentations and casual outings alike. But mastering its subtleties can be difficult. It's not just about selecting the perfect fit; it's about honing a style that embodies confidence and professionalism.

  • First, consider the fabric. A high-quality cotton, like Egyptian or Supima, will offer a soft feel and resist wrinkles better than its cheaper counterparts.
  • Secondly, avoid anything too tight or too loose. A well-tailored shirt should accentuate your body without feeling restrictive.
  • Lastly, pay attention to the details. Ironing yourshirt neatly, selecting the right collar style for your face shape, and paying attention to your cuffs can all make a impact.
